I look out over the Youth and the young children in our church and I see such potential. Girls and boys who are going to do great things for God right at the age that they are at.
Now when I see a young teen boy I see God giving them a steel rod running down behind their backs something to do with standing up straight for the things of God and not bending and swaying in the wind of false doctrines and the opinions of those who do not speak the truth. Teen Girls I see as buds in our church. When you look at a rose bush you will see that their is a main bloom and buds on the sides under the rose. We older women are to be sturdy rose bushes gathering our buds close and teaching them how to love, nurture and speak truth to others that cross their paths. Just as aphids and rain will come and try to attack the delicate buds we are to impart our wisdom to our girls so that they will not fall prey to aphids or be damaged by heavy rain.
The young boys and girls from the very little are like our butterflies and bees. They are the beauty of our church. So refreshing and delightful. They flit from flower to flower, always alert and soaking in all the nectar and pollen. They will make something out of what they gather and will take it and give to others. What they have learnt, will stay with them and will 'rub off' on to others who do not know Jesus.
